终极指南:如何用go-cursor-help轻松突破Cursor免费试用限制
你是否在使用Cursor AI编辑器时遇到过"此机器已使用过多免费试用账户"或"已达到试用请求限制"的烦人提示?作为开发者,这些限制常常打断你的编程流程。今天,我将为你介绍一个开源解决方案——go-cursor-help,这是一个专门为突破Cursor免费试用限制而设计的跨平台工具,让你重新获得AI编程助手的完整功能。go-cursor-help通过智能重置设备标识符,让Cursor系统识别你
终极指南:如何用go-cursor-help轻松突破Cursor免费试用限制
你是否在使用Cursor AI编辑器时遇到过"此机器已使用过多免费试用账户"或"已达到试用请求限制"的烦人提示?作为开发者,这些限制常常打断你的编程流程。今天,我将为你介绍一个开源解决方案——go-cursor-help,这是一个专门为突破Cursor免费试用限制而设计的跨平台工具,让你重新获得AI编程助手的完整功能。
go-cursor-help通过智能重置设备标识符,让Cursor系统识别你的设备为全新设备,从而绕过试用次数和设备的限制。无论你是Windows、macOS还是Linux用户,这个工具都能提供简单易用的解决方案。
🔍 问题诊断:识别你的Cursor使用瓶颈
在使用go-cursor-help之前,你需要先了解自己遇到的是哪种限制。Cursor的防护机制主要通过三种方式实施限制:
设备关联限制
当你看到"Too many free trial accounts used on this machine"提示时,说明你的硬件设备已经被标记。即使你创建新账户,Cursor仍然能识别出这是同一台设备。这种限制基于设备指纹技术,需要修改系统级的设备标识才能解决。
请求配额限制
如果你的提示是"You've reached your trial request limit",这意味着你的账户使用频率超出了免费用户的限制。Cursor为免费用户设置了AI交互次数的上限,通常每7-14天会自动重置一次。
服务冲突限制
使用自定义API密钥时,你可能遇到"Composer relies on custom models that cannot be billed to an API key"错误。这是因为Cursor的部分高级功能仅对付费用户开放API访问权限。
🚀 三步配置指南:go-cursor-help快速上手
准备工作
在开始之前,请确保:
- 环境要求:Windows 10/11(64位)、macOS 12+或Linux(内核5.4+)
- 权限准备:需要管理员/root权限执行系统配置修改
- Cursor版本:支持最新的2.x.x版本
Windows系统操作指南
Windows用户的操作最为简单,只需几个步骤:
- 获取管理员权限 - 这是最关键的一步。你可以通过以下方式打开管理员PowerShell:
- 按下Win + X,选择"Windows PowerShell (管理员)"
- 或者在搜索框中输入"pwsh",右键选择"以管理员身份运行"
Windows系统中以管理员身份运行PowerShell的界面
- 执行重置脚本 - 在管理员PowerShell中运行以下命令:
irm https://raw.githubusercontent.com/yuaotian/go-cursor-help/refs/heads/master/scripts/run/cursor_win_id_modifier.ps1 | iex
脚本会自动完成所有配置修改,包括:
- 关闭Cursor进程(请确保已保存所有编辑内容)
- 备份原始配置文件
- 生成新的设备标识符
- 修改系统注册表
macOS系统操作指南
macOS用户需要通过终端执行:
curl -fsSL https://raw.githubusercontent.com/yuaotian/go-cursor-help/refs/heads/master/scripts/run/cursor_mac_id_modifier.sh -o ./cursor_mac_id_modifier.sh && sudo bash ./cursor_mac_id_modifier.sh && rm ./cursor_mac_id_modifier.sh
Linux系统操作指南
Linux用户可以使用以下命令:
curl -fsSL https://raw.githubusercontent.com/yuaotian/go-cursor-help/refs/heads/master/scripts/run/cursor_linux_id_modifier.sh | sudo bash
✅ 验证与成功确认
执行完脚本后,你将看到类似下面的成功界面:
界面中会显示以下关键信息:
- ✅ 配置文件修改完成
- 📁 原始配置备份位置
- 🔄 新生成的设备标识符
- 💡 后续使用建议
重启Cursor后,你可以通过以下方式验证重置是否成功:
- 检查是否不再显示试用限制提示
- AI交互功能是否恢复正常
- 查看设置中的账户状态
🔧 技术原理深度解析
go-cursor-help的工作原理相当巧妙,它通过修改多个关键配置来让Cursor识别为全新设备:
配置文件深度修改
工具会定位并修改Cursor的storage.json配置文件,该文件位于:
- Windows:
%APPDATA%\Cursor\User\globalStorage\ - macOS:
~/Library/Application Support/Cursor/User/globalStorage/ - Linux:
~/.config/Cursor/User/globalStorage/
多维度标识重置
工具会自动生成全新的唯一标识符替换以下关键字段:
telemetry.machineId: 设备硬件标识telemetry.macMachineId: macOS设备专属标识telemetry.devDeviceId: 开发设备IDtelemetry.sqmId: 服务质量监控ID
安全机制保障
go-cursor-help在修改前会自动备份原始配置,确保你可以随时恢复。备份文件保存在专门的备份目录中,格式为MachineGuid.backup_YYYYMMDD_HHMMSS。
🎯 最佳实践技巧
自动化重置方案
为了避免频繁手动操作,你可以设置定时任务自动重置:
Windows任务计划程序配置:
- 创建基本任务,触发条件设为"每月"
- 操作选择"启动程序",程序路径为
pwsh.exe - 添加参数:
-File "C:\path\to\go-cursor-help\scripts\run\cursor_win_id_modifier.ps1"
Linux/macOS cron任务:
# 每月1日凌晨3点执行
0 3 1 * * /path/to/go-cursor-help/scripts/run/cursor_linux_id_modifier.sh
多设备同步策略
如果你在多台设备上使用Cursor,可以:
- 将工具目录同步至云存储(如OneDrive、Dropbox)
- 在各设备创建符号链接指向同步目录
- 使用版本控制工具管理自定义配置
故障排除指南
如果遇到问题,可以尝试以下解决方案:
脚本执行失败:
- 检查是否以管理员/root权限运行
- 确认网络连接正常
- 查看Cursor是否正在运行(需要先关闭)
重置后限制仍然存在:
- 彻底清理Cursor缓存目录
- 重启系统后重试
- 检查防火墙或安全软件是否阻止了脚本
📚 进阶应用场景
企业环境部署
对于团队使用,你可以:
- 将脚本集成到企业软件分发系统
- 创建统一的配置管理策略
- 设置定期自动重置计划
开发环境优化
结合其他开发工具,你可以:
- 将重置脚本集成到开发环境初始化流程
- 创建开发环境快照,包含已重置的Cursor配置
- 使用容器化技术隔离不同项目的Cursor环境
教育机构应用
对于教学环境,建议:
- 为每个学生创建独立的设备标识
- 设置学期开始时统一重置
- 集成到实验室计算机的启动脚本中
🔄 社区支持与贡献
go-cursor-help是一个开源项目,欢迎社区参与:
如何贡献
- 提交Issue:报告bug或建议新功能
- 改进脚本兼容性:支持更多系统版本和Cursor版本
- 优化文档:提供更清晰的使用说明
- 翻译项目:将文档翻译成其他语言
常见问题解答
Q: 这个工具安全吗? A: 工具只修改Cursor的配置文件和必要的系统标识,不会修改其他系统文件,且在修改前会自动备份。
Q: 重置后我的项目设置会丢失吗? A: 不会。工具只修改设备标识相关配置,不会影响你的项目设置、插件或主题。
Q: 需要每次使用Cursor都重置吗? A: 不需要。一次重置通常可以持续使用一段时间,具体取决于你的使用频率。
Q: 支持哪些Cursor版本? A: 支持最新的2.x.x版本,包括Windows、macOS和Linux系统。
🎁 项目资源与扩展
核心脚本文件
- Windows脚本: scripts/run/cursor_win_id_modifier.ps1
- macOS脚本: scripts/run/cursor_mac_id_modifier.sh
- Linux脚本: scripts/run/cursor_linux_id_modifier.sh
配置文件位置
了解配置文件位置有助于手动备份和恢复:
- Windows:
%APPDATA%\Cursor\User\globalStorage\storage.json - macOS:
~/Library/Application Support/Cursor/User/globalStorage/storage.json - Linux:
~/.config/Cursor/User/globalStorage/storage.json
手动安装选项
如果你更喜欢手动安装,可以从项目仓库下载对应的可执行文件:
- Windows: cursor-id-modifier_windows_x64.exe
- macOS: cursor-id-modifier_darwin_x64_intel(Intel)或cursor-id-modifier_darwin_arm64_apple_silicon(Apple Silicon)
- Linux: cursor-id-modifier_linux_x64
💡 使用建议与注意事项
最佳使用时机
- 试用期结束时:在收到限制提示后立即使用
- 设备更换时:在新设备上安装Cursor后
- 定期维护:每月执行一次保持最佳状态
注意事项
- 保存工作:执行脚本前请确保已保存所有编辑内容
- 网络连接:确保网络通畅以下载最新脚本
- 权限问题:Windows用户需要管理员权限,macOS/Linux用户需要sudo权限
- 版本兼容:确认你的Cursor版本在支持范围内
性能优化建议
- 结合使用:配合网络优化工具获得更好的AI响应速度
- 资源管理:定期清理Cursor缓存文件
- 插件选择:只安装必要的插件以减少资源占用
🚀 开始使用go-cursor-help
现在你已经了解了go-cursor-help的全部功能和使用方法。这个工具为Cursor用户提供了一个简单、安全、有效的解决方案,让你能够持续享受AI编程助手的强大功能,而不受试用限制的困扰。
无论你是个人开发者、学生还是企业用户,go-cursor-help都能帮助你最大化Cursor的使用价值。记住,开源工具的价值在于社区的共享和贡献,如果你在使用过程中有任何改进建议或成功经验,欢迎分享给社区。
开始你的无限制AI编程之旅吧!选择适合你系统的脚本,按照指南操作,几分钟后你就能重新获得完整的Cursor功能。祝你编程愉快!
提示:为了获得最佳体验,建议定期关注项目更新,获取最新的功能改进和兼容性修复。
更多推荐





所有评论(0)